
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a baking dish.
In a large bowl, combine the diced tomatoes, minced garlic, chopped basil, olive oil, salt, and pepper. Mix well.
Pour half of the tomato mixture into the prepared baking dish.
Arrange slices of mozzarella cheese over the tomato mixture.
Pour the remaining tomato mixture over the mozzarella cheese.
Bake in the preheated oven for 30-40 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ly, and the tomatoes are tender.
Garnish with fresh basil leaves before serving. Serve hot with crusty bread.
